+/*  Copyright Mihai Bazon, 2002, 2003  |  http://dynarch.com/mishoo/
+ * 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
+ *
+ * The DHTML Calendar
+ *
+ * Details and latest version at:
+ * http://dynarch.com/mishoo/calendar.epl
+ *
+ * This script is distributed under the GNU Lesser General Public License.
+ * Read the entire license text here: http://www.gnu.org/licenses/lgpl.html
+ *
+ * This file defines helper functions for setting up the calendar.  They are
+ * intended to help non-programmers get a working calendar on their site
+ * quickly.  This script should not be seen as part of the calendar.  It just
+ * shows you what one can do with the calendar, while in the same time
+ * providing a quick and simple method for setting it up.  If you need
+ * exhaustive customization of the calendar creation process feel free to
+ * modify this code to suit your needs (this is recommended and much better
+ * than modifying calendar.js itself).
+ */
+
+// $Id: calendar-setup.js,v 1.1 2007/05/23 16:25:02 tipaul Exp $
+
+/**
+ *  This function "patches" an input field (or other element) to use a calendar
+ *  widget for date selection.
+ *
+ *  The "params" is a single object that can have the following properties:
+ *
+ *    prop. name   | description
+ *  -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+ *   inputField    | the ID of an input field to store the date
+ *   displayArea   | the ID of a DIV or other element to show the date
+ *   button        | ID of a button or other element that will trigger the calendar
+ *   eventName     | event that will trigger the calendar, without the "on" prefix (default: "click")
+ *   ifFormat      | date format that will be stored in the input field
+ *   daFormat      | the date format that will be used to display the date in displayArea
+ *   singleClick   | (true/false) wether the calendar is in single click mode or not (default: true)
+ *   firstDay      | numeric: 0 to 6.  "0" means display Sunday first, "1" means display Monday first, etc.
+ *   align         | alignment (default: "Br"); if you don't know what's this see the calendar documentation
+ *   range         | array with 2 elements.  Default: [1900, 2999] -- the range of years available
+ *   weekNumbers   | (true/false) if it's true (default) the calendar will display week numbers
+ *   flat          | null or element ID; if not null the calendar will be a flat calendar having the parent with the given ID
+ *   flatCallback  | function that receives a JS Date object and returns an URL to point the browser to (for flat calendar)
+ *   disableFunc   | function that receives a JS Date object and should return true if that date has to be disabled in the calendar
+ *   onSelect      | function that gets called when a date is selected.  You don't _have_ to supply this (the default is generally okay)
+ *   onClose       | function that gets called when the calendar is closed.  [default]
+ *   onUpdate      | function that gets called after the date is updated in the input field.  Receives a reference to the calendar.
+ *   date          | the date that the calendar will be initially displayed to
+ *   showsTime     | default: false; if true the calendar will include a time selector
+ *   timeFormat    | the time format; can be "12" or "24", default is "12"
+ *   electric      | if true (default) then given fields/date areas are updated for each move; otherwise they're updated only on close
+ *   step          | configures the step of the years in drop-down boxes; default: 2
+ *   position      | configures the calendar absolute position; default: null
+ *   cache         | if "true" (but default: "false") it will reuse the same calendar object, where possible
+ *   showOthers    | if "true" (but default: "false") it will show days from other months too
+ *
+ *  None of them is required, they all have default values.  However, if you
+ *  pass none of "inputField", "displayArea" or "button" you'll get a warning
+ *  saying "nothing to setup".
+ */
